Brussel Sprout Slaw

Brussels Sprout Slaw Recipe

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 168

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b Brussels sprouts, trimmed
  • 1 medium carrot
  • 1/4 cup dried cranberries
  • 1/4 cup sliced almonds, toasted
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
  • 1 tsp honey
  • 3 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
  • Salt, to taste
  • Black pepper, to taste

Method
 

  1. Whisk together lemon juice, Dijon, honey, olive oil, salt, and pepper in a large bowl until smooth, about 30 seconds. Taste and adjust.
  2. Shred the Brussels sprouts using a food processor, box grater, or sharp knife. Transfer to the bowl.
  3. Add the carrot, cranberries, and almonds. Toss well, massaging the dressing into the sprouts for about 30 seconds. Let sit at least 5 minutes, then serve.

Notes

This slaw keeps well. For the best texture and flavor, refrigerate it for 30 minutes before serving so the sprouts soften slightly and the flavors meld. The almonds will lose their crunch over time, so if you are making it far ahead, stir them in just before serving.
